Abstract

The utility model relates to a kind of performance test experiment tables for single screw compressor, including:Power unit:It is connect with the main shaft of single screw compressor to be measured, for driving the main shaft of single screw compressor to rotate;Gas-liquid separator:Its import is connect with the outlet of single screw compressor to be measured, its liquid-phase outlet is connect by pipeline with the lubricating fluid import of single screw compressor to be measured, its gaseous phase outlet passes sequentially through air accumulator, airflow measurement unit and surge tank, then connect with the gas access of single screw compressor to be measured;Detection unit:Including for detecting single screw compressor out temperature to be measured and pressure sensor group, for detecting the airflow measurement unit for detecting single screw compressor capacity to be measured.Compared with prior art, the utility model can simulate the working condition of single screw compressor, and analysis obtains the corresponding best hydrojet flow of different model single screw compressor host and hydrojet temperature, obtains optimal performance operating point, accelerate research and development rhythm.

Background technique
Currently, the process gas single screw compressor market demand is increasingly vigorous.However, the compbined test of single screw compressor is ground Study carefully and still have many blank, directly affects product development process.Especially high-power unit is at various operating conditions Dry run, reliability, the complete machine of machine chief components are economical, reliability requires further to study, and need big Power processes gas single screw compressor synthesis experiment platform.
Utility model content
The purpose of this utility model is exactly to provide a kind of for single spiral shell to overcome the problems of the above-mentioned prior art The performance test experiment table of bar compressor.
The purpose of this utility model can be achieved through the following technical solutions:A kind of performance for single screw compressor Test experimental bed, the experimental bench include:
Power unit:It is connect with the main shaft of single screw compressor to be measured, for driving the main shaft of single screw compressor to rotate;
Gas-liquid separator:Its import is connect with the outlet of single screw compressor to be measured, liquid-phase outlet by pipeline with to The lubricating fluid import connection of single screw compressor is surveyed, gaseous phase outlet passes sequentially through air accumulator, airflow measurement unit and surge tank, Then it is connect with the gas access of single screw compressor to be measured;
Detection unit:Including for detecting single screw compressor out temperature to be measured and pressure sensor group, be used for Detection detects the airflow measurement unit of single screw compressor capacity to be measured and for detecting single screw compressor shaft work to be measured The torque sensor of rate.
Before test, single screw compressor to be measured is installed to experimental bench, main shaft is connect with power unit, will be imported and exported It is connect respectively with gas-liquid separator with surge tank, the liquid-phase outlet connection of lubricating fluid import and gas-liquid separator, then with air Simulation process gas, turn on the power unit, detects the number such as temperature, pressure, flow of single screw compressor to be measured by detection unit According to obtain the performance parameter of single screw compressor to be measured, such as shaft power, volume flow, volumetric efficiency, volumetric ratio can.
The power unit is high-pressure frequency-conversion motor, and single screw compressor to be measured is arranged in the torque sensor Between main shaft and high-pressure frequency-conversion motor.High-pressure frequency-conversion motor may be implemented online compressor host variable speed, become spouting liquid with And subject is tested in the variable working condition such as cooling fan variable air rate, torque sensor can monitor the rotation of single screw compressor main shaft to be measured Torque.
Heat exchanger is equipped between the gas-liquid separator and air accumulator to be cooled down.
It is equipped with filter between the gas access of the surge tank and single screw compressor to be measured, avoids carrying in air Impurity the screw rod and star-wheel of single screw compressor to be measured are caused to wear.
The airflow measurement unit includes the orifice flowmeter and nozzle that multiple groups are arranged in parallel, every group of orifice flowmeter and The measurement range of nozzle is different and is gradually increased, and the measurement range of airflow measurement unit is 20~120M3/min.Detection data is more Accurately.
Preferably, the quantity of the orifice flowmeter is 3.
The sensor group include the temperature sensor that single screw compressor inlet and outlet to be measured is set, setting exist Pressure sensor on single screw compressor outlet to be measured, gas-liquid separator, air accumulator and surge tank.
Between the gas-liquid separator liquid-phase outlet and the lubricating fluid import of single screw compressor to be measured be equipped with heat exchanger into Row cooling.
It is equipped with evacuation port at the top of the gas-liquid separator, and is equipped with muffler, the gas-liquid separator bottom in evacuation port Equipped with condensate drain mouth.
The experimental bench is additionally provided with the processor being connect with power unit and detection unit for controlling and collecting data.Such as PLC controller, and be connected by the fieldbus and processor of industry control host computer, needs are directly inputted on the screen of industrial personal computer Revolving speed.It realizes online compressor host variable speed, become the variable working condition such as spouting liquid and cooling fan variable air rate test subject.
The test method of the utility model is as follows:
1, according to the suitable orifice flowmeter of single screw compressor type Capacity Selection to be measured, related nameplate parameter is inputted, is done Electric control valve inside measuring device is adjusted for the evaluation criterion of measurement result, pressure at expulsion is made to reach tested state.
2, it runs to single screw compressor to be measured to steady working condition, starts report capability.All control parameters and test are surveyed Parameter is measured, is connect by data/address bus with upper industrial personal computer, computer data acquiring and all test contents of monitoring system are constituted Achievable automatic measurement, calculating, generates the functions such as report and storage at real-time display;
3, it is automatically performed the judgement of test result, the division including efficiency grade.
Compared with prior art, the beneficial effects of the utility model are embodied in following several respects:
(1) can simulate the working condition of single screw compressor, analysis obtain different model single screw compressor host with Corresponding best hydrojet flow and hydrojet temperature, can not only optimize molded lines of rotor, but also single screw compressor can be optimized Liquid channel system and external cooling system, obtain optimal performance operating point inside host, improve research and development quality, accelerate research and development section It plays;
(2) adaptable, and measurement range is wide;
(3) high degree of automation.
